Determining Item Pricing for Maximum Profitability

To achieve maximum profitability in your business, it's essential to understand the art of item pricing. Carefully assessing costs, recognizing market demand, and examining competitor prices are crucial steps in this process. By implementing a strategic pricing strategy, you can optimize your revenue while serving customer expectations.

  • Create a clear understanding of your cost structure, including both fixed and variable expenses.
  • Carefully research market trends and customer preferences to identify optimal pricing points.
  • Assess competitor pricing strategies and distinguish your offerings accordingly.
  • Deploy a pricing model that coordinates with your business goals and brand image.
  • Monitor sales data and customer opinions to adjust your pricing strategy as needed.

Optimizing Inventory Management for Loss Reduction

Maintaining accurate product quantities is crucial for any business. Inefficient inventory control can lead to a number of problems, including excess stock that ties up capital, unavailability of goods that disrupt operations, and increased warehousing costs. To minimize these negative impacts, businesses must implement comprehensive inventory control methods. This involves consistently auditing product availability and using technology to optimize the entire process. By adopting best practices, businesses can minimize inventory click here expenditure, boost profitability, and ensure customer satisfaction.

Assessing Sales Data for Item Performance Insights

Diving deep into your transactional data can unlock valuable understandings about the performance of individual merchandise. By analyzing behaviors in sales figures, you can identify which products are excelling, as well as those that may need further optimization. This assessment can shape your inventory management to boost overall success.

  • Essential data points to examine include sales volume, spending per purchase, and customer lifetime value.
  • Employing data visualization tools can generate easier to understand displays of these data points, supporting rapid discovery of key findings.
  • Consistently analyzing your sales data can offer a continuous perception of market trends, allowing you to adjust your strategies for maximum impact.

Crafting a Successful Sales Funnel for Your Products

A well-defined sales funnel is essential for driving conversions and maximizing revenue. It's the roadmap that guides potential customers from initial exposure to becoming loyal buyers. To create a winning funnel, start by pinpointing your target audience and their needs. Then, categorize them based on their behavior and interaction levels. Next, create a series of stages that move prospects through the buying process. Each stage should include targeted content and offers that resolve their pain points at that particular stage. Continuously analyze your funnel's performance, using metrics like conversion rates and drop-off points to identify areas for enhancement. By adjusting your funnel based on data and customer feedback, you can increase sales and achieve sustainable growth.

The Art of Upselling and Cross-Selling for Increased Revenue

Unlocking substantial revenue streams is a key objective for any business. Leveraging the art of upselling and cross-selling can be a powerful way to achieve this. Upselling involves enticing customers to purchase higher-value items, while cross-selling encourages them to add relevant products with their current purchase. By implementing these techniques, businesses can boost customer experience and generate overall profit.

  • To effectively execute upselling and cross-selling strategies, companies should perform thorough customer segmentation to determine their requirements.
  • Suggesting personalized proposals based on client preferences and buying history is crucial.
  • Educating sales staff to effectively present the value of enhanced options can remarkably impact conversion rates.
